RE: First Byte Time Grade
OK. I see:
The summary page gives the result of the run 4 which is the median run. Other pages are based on the data of run 1 unless you select another run. Maybe the run number could be added in the page you are looking at. Presently, I can only guess this number by looking at the URL. |
